High
Performance Computing

In June, 2003,
Navatek acquired a 128 processor Linux cluster for
use in its research and development on ship hull designs and underwater lifting bodies. This cluster, nicknamed Neptune (the Roman god of the sea), is used primarily for running Computational
Fluid Dynamics (CFD) software applications as USAERO, LAMP, and CFX. In 2007 Navatek added a second Linux cluster nicknamed Poseidon (the Greek god of the sea). Poseidon and its 36 processors has more than doubled the computing power at Navatek's research and development office.
